Offshore wind energy is a promising solution to the environment and energy crisis thanks to its excellent performance of production. It would be further developed with the support from low-carbon economy. This paper summarizes the configuration of offshore wind power systems and surveys their optimal planning methods. Methods of offshore wind farm siting, common topologies of collecting systems and different transmission schemes are reviewed, while reliability evaluation is discussed in detail. Based on this, modeling approaches and algorithms for optimal planning of offshore wind power systems are briefly treated. Finally, some suggestions for potential research directions of optimal planning of offshore wind power systems are made.
